The Valiyazheekkal Bridge or the Valiyazheekkal-Azheekkal Bridge is a bridge connecting between Valiyazheekkal, a coastal area of Aratupuzha village in Kayamkulam in Alappuzha district and Azheekal Beach in Alappad village of Kollam district in Kerala, India. Built across the mouth of the Arabian Sea, it is the longest tension steel bar concrete bowstring bridge in Asia.
